Output 143959ca7609c5a7d8dc73a46dbc2bfa9792384175ad6b6814c5ec7fec640d94:11

value
308708680
script pubkey
OP_0 OP_PUSHBYTES_20 58811ede3914c41fc72669db63ea907709e5ec76
address
bc1qtzq3ah3eznzpl3exd8dk865swuy7tmrkgtjev5
transaction
143959ca7609c5a7d8dc73a46dbc2bfa9792384175ad6b6814c5ec7fec640d94
spent
true